(a)In this section, “clinical material” means:
(1)An organism isolated from a clinical specimen;
(2)Material derived or prepared from a clinical specimen in which evidence of a communicable disease has been identified or detected; or
(3)If the organism or material described in subparagraph (i) or (ii) of this paragraph is not available, material from an individual that has already been obtained by the medical laboratory, in the following order of preference:
(i)A patient specimen;
(ii)Microbial genetic material; or
(iii)Other laboratory material.
